We have been looking at flights to Brisbane (with Singapore Airlines) and have a query about the flight changeover at Singapore.

 

We do not intend to have a long stopover - would rather do the flight to Oz in one go. With this in mind, we have looked at flights with a 4/5 hour arrival / departure in Singapore.

 

My question is - what exactly is the procedure for arrivals / departures at Singapore??

Do we have to go through passport control ? baggage reclaim ? customs ? or are you directed to the second flight and your baggage is transferred to the next flight automatically???

Hiya Tinks

 

We have flown with Singapore airlines and are travelling with them again soon.

 

Your baggage is already put onto your connecting flight for you , so no mucking about at all.

 

The airport at Singpaore is lovely, lots of nice eateries and bars etc.. it is actually for an airport a lovely place to wait for your connecting flight. You can even take a swim if you wish as the airport has a pool there.

Hi, we can answer one question - buggies (so long as it is a stroller) on Singapore Airlines. Yes you can use it at Singapore airport. We did on our rekkie trip to AU in April this year. Just check it in as normal and wheel your child to the departure gate. The staff there will label it and take it off you and then its stored somewhere in the passenger bay rather than the luggage hold.

Can I just add that when you are leaving do not buy any duty free alcohol at the UK airport, as Singapore airport will take it from you, they want it packed in a special way, so it's best to buy any alcohol at Changi, this has happened to a few people I know, it's because of the 100ml rule on flights, on another note for those with not enough time to shop in Singapore airport because of your connections, you should be able to buy yours on entry once you touchdown at the Aussie airport. I know you can do this at Sydney before you come through passport control, so it might be an idea if anyone else can tell you the same for Brissie, Perth, Adelaide etc., Hope this helps.:wubclub:
